Sounds like your hair might not have been totally dry when you took the rollers out. It could have been the humidity as well. Whenever my roller sets frizz quickly I know I didn't let my hair dry completely. HTH
 
I agree with Simplycee. Sometimes rollerset can trick you. You remove the rollers and the hair feels nice and warm. But a few seconds later, it feels cool. This means the hair wasnt dry all the way.

You might wanna chuck the setting lotion, particularly if you are wearing your hair straight. Setting lotion makes the hair take longer to dry ironically.
